Skip to content

Global router fails if there are too many ports on the floorplan #22

@oharboe

Description

@oharboe

I'm currently experiencing a crash with alpha-release in FRlefdef, but I don't know how to debug it:

  1. The FRlefdef included the alpha-release Docker image contains no debug information, nor is the source included.
  2. Trivial modules work, it's impractical without a deep understanding of the system how to reduce this to a small example
  3. The output from FRlefdef is uninformative, see below.
  4. What I'm testing OpenROAD on is proprietary, so at best I could provide an obfuscated somewhat scaled down version.
# FRlefdef --no-gui --script ./objects/nangate45/LEArrayScanChain/fastroute.rsyn
[deleted]
LV routing round 2, enlarge 20 
1 threshold, 20 expand
total Usage   : 2368335
Max H Overflow: 23
Max V Overflow: 2887
Max Overflow  : 2887
Num Overflow e: 6277
H   Overflow  : 3494
V   Overflow  : 231494
Final Overflow: 234988

LV Time: 3.870000 sec
updateType 1
iteration 1, enlarge 9, costheight 34, threshold 0 via cost 0 
log_coef 0.223050, healingTrigger 0 cost_step 30 L 0 cost_type 1 updatetype 1
initial grid wrong y1 x1 [0 0] , net start [10 0] routelen 305
 checking failed 0
Segmentation fault (core dumped)

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type
    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ions